    It’s so simple to make and serve in a pretty crystal bowl.  Just mix raspberry jello (your choice of sweetened or unsweetened), mix in a bag of frozen raspberries and unsweetened applesauce and refrigerate. That’s it!  I chose to use the unsweetened jello to keep the carbs down.

    Ingredients for Raspberry Apple Jello Salad

    1 (3 oz) box raspberry jello (regular or unsweetened based on your sugar preferences)

    1 cup boiling water

    1 cup unsweetened applesauce

    1 cup frozen raspberries

    To Double:

    2 (3 oz) boxes raspberry jello (regular or unsweetened based on your sugar preferences)

    2 cups boiling water

    1 ½ cups unsweetened applesauce

    1 ½ cups (12 oz) frozen raspberries

    How to Make Raspberry Apple Jello Salad

    Add jello mix to a serving bowl of choice.

    Add boiling water and stir until mixed. (approx 2 minutes)

    Add frozen raspberries

    Then stir in applesauce.

    Cover with plastic wrap.

    Refrigerate for 4 hours or until set completely.

    Raspberry Apple Jello Salad

    This festive, delicious Raspberry Apple Jello Salad is perfect for a holiday dinner or anytime you want something sweet but a little tart in your day. It’s so, so good!!
    5 from 6 votes
    Prevent your screen from going dark
    Print Pin Rate
    Course: Side Dish
    Cuisine: American
    Prep Time: 15 minutes
    Cook Time: 4 hours
    Total Time: 4 hours 15 minutes
    Servings: 8
    Calories: 41kcal
    Author: Sherri Hagymas

    Ingredients

    • 3 ounces box raspberry jello (regular or unsweetened based on your sugar preferences)
    • 1 cup boiling water
    • 1 cup all natural unsweetened applesauce
    • 1 cup frozen raspberries
    • To Double:
    • 6 ounces raspberry jello (2- 3 oz. boxes regular or unsweetened based on your sugar preferences)
    • 2 cups boiling water
    • 1 ½ cups all natural unsweetened applesauce
    • 1 ½ cups 12 oz frozen raspberries

    Instructions

    • Add jello mix to a serving bowl of choice.
    • Add boiling water and stir until mixed. (approx 2 minutes)
    • Add frozen raspberries
    • Then stir in applesauce.
    • Cover with plastic wrap.
    • Refrigerate for 4 hours or until set completely.
    • ENJOY!!

    Notes

    Nutritional information is with sugar free raspberry jello

    Nutrition

    Calories: 41kcal | Carbohydrates: 13g | Protein: 1g | Sodium: 92mg | Potassium: 45mg | Fiber: 1g | Sugar: 3g | Vitamin A: 10IU | Vitamin C: 4.2mg | Calcium: 4mg | Iron: 0.2mg
